Muse Spark 1.2 vs 1.1: Same Price, Six More Points, Four Times the Wait

Meta’s Muse Spark 1.2 arrived on August 5, four weeks after 1.1, with an identical rate card, an identical context window, an identical modality list and an identical reasoning dial. It scores meaningfully higher on every independent index — and it is also roughly four times slower to first token in production, and costs about 38% more per completed task. Whether that adds up to an upgrade depends entirely on what you’re building; we worked through the matchup in detail in our full 1.1 vs 1.2 head-to-head, and this is the decision-focused version.

Version upgrades are usually easy calls: the new one is better, costs the same or less, and you move on. This one isn’t — and the reason is a number neither Meta nor the benchmark sites publish.

What is genuinely identical

Before the differences, it’s worth being clear how much didn’t move, because it’s unusual:

• Price — $1.25 input, $0.15 cached input, $4.25 output on both. Meta did not reprice.

• Context window — 1,048,576 tokens on both; 131,072 maximum output on both.

• Modalities — text, image, video, file and audio in, text out, on both.

• Reasoning — mandatory on both, same `minimal`→`xhigh` dial, same `medium` default.

• Weights — closed on both.

Put the two spec sheets side by side and you cannot tell them apart. Everything that separates these models is behavioural, which means everything that separates them has to come from measurement.

What moved: the index

Artificial Analysis is the cleanest generational read, because it runs the same fixed task set across every model it tracks.

• Muse Spark 1.0 (April) — 43

• Muse Spark 1.1 (July 9) — 51

• Muse Spark 1.2 (August 5) — 57 on the live board today

One caveat that trips up most coverage: AA’s launch-day article scored 1.2 at 54, and that’s the figure still circulating in almost everything written in the past week. The live model page has since been revised to 57, ranking it #12 of 185 models. If you’re comparing numbers across articles, check the date.

Either way the direction is clear and the magnitude is real: fourteen index points across four months, and six of them in the last four weeks, on an unchanged price.

Where did the gain come from? Agentic and long-horizon work, consistently. AA’s launch measurements showed GDPval-AA v2 rising to 1631 Elo (#5) from 1371 — a 260-point jump — with Terminal-Bench v2.1 moving 78% to 80% and τ³-Banking 25% to 27%. There’s also a behavioural shift worth naming: 1.2 abstains more. Its hallucination rate fell from 38% to 28%, while raw accuracy fell from 41% to 38%. It got more careful, not only more capable.

What moved the other way: speed

This is the part that isn’t on any benchmark site, because the benchmark sites don’t have it. Artificial Analysis lists no output speed and no time-to-first-token for Muse Spark 1.2 — both fields read N/A. Production telemetry is the only source.

On OrcaRouter’s seven-day window, at the same list price on the same platform:

• Muse Spark 1.2 — p50 time to first token 7.73 s, p95 10.00 s

• Muse Spark 1.1 — p50 time to first token 1.93 s, p95 8.13 s

That is a four-fold regression at the median. Vals AI’s independent runs corroborate the direction from a different angle, averaging roughly 610 seconds per test.

This isn’t a bug and it isn’t a provider problem. It is the mechanical consequence of a model that deliberates more: AA measured 1.2 burning 95 million output tokens to complete the index, and the cost per task rose from $0.29 to $0.40 on unchanged pricing — a 38% increase for a six-point gain.

So the trade is legible. You are buying reasoning depth with latency and tokens.

The one thing 1.1 has that 1.2 doesn’t

Here’s an inversion most upgrade guides miss: on the *official* Terminal-Bench 2.1 leaderboard, version 1.1 has an independently verified entry and version 1.2 does not.

The board lists mini-SWE-agent + Muse Spark 1.1 at 76.2% ± 1.2%, xhigh, submitted by Princeton on July 9, 2026, at rank 8 with a run cost of $198.05. There is no Muse Spark 1.2 row. There is no Muse Code row either.

Meta’s claim for 1.2 is 82.9% on that benchmark, with a stated 6.7-point gain over the previous version. Subtract and you get 76.2 — exactly the board’s figure for 1.1 under a deliberately minimal third-party scaffold. Meta never published the harness behind its baseline, so this is an inference rather than a proven fact. But if the baseline is that row, the “+6.7” is comparing a bare scaffold to Meta’s own co-trained agent, and part of that gain belongs to the harness rather than the model.

The practical consequence: if you need a coding score you can point to in a review, 1.1 currently has one and 1.2 has a vendor claim.

Who should upgrade, and who shouldn’t

Upgrade if your workload is agentic, long-horizon or document-heavy — multi-step tool use, whole-repository refactors, batch analysis, overnight jobs. The six index points and the 260-Elo agentic jump are concentrated exactly there, and latency is nearly free in a background job.

Upgrade if hallucination is a bigger risk to you than a missed answer. The abstention shift is a genuine safety improvement for anything user-facing that gets fact-checked.

Stay on 1.1 if anything human-facing depends on first-token latency. Two seconds versus eight is the difference between a usable interactive experience and a spinner, and you gain nothing else by moving, because the price is the same either way.

Stay on 1.1 if you need the verified third-party coding number more than the vendor-claimed one.

Run both if you can. They cost the same, they take the same request format, and they differ only in a trade-off that varies by task. The takeaway

Muse Spark 1.2 is a real improvement over 1.1 on every independent measure of intelligence, at exactly the same price — and it is four times slower to answer and a third more expensive per finished task. That makes this an unusually clean decision rather than a difficult one: if your work happens in the background, take the upgrade; if a person is waiting on the response, the older version is still the right tool and costs you nothing to keep. The one thing you should not do is assume the newer version is strictly better, because on latency and on independently verified coding results, it currently isn’t.

Sourcing note: pricing, context window and the 82.9% / +6.7 benchmark claims are Meta’s own published figures, unreproduced by third parties. Index scores, cost per task, token consumption and agentic sub-results are from Artificial Analysis; the 76.2% row is from the official Terminal-Bench 2.1 leaderboard; per-test latency from Vals AI; p50 and p95 first-token figures are OrcaRouter’s own seven-day production telemetry. The 82.9 − 6.7 = 76.2 observation is our inference. Checked August 7, 2026.
